Online Registration Opening for Summer Credit Courses on April 13

Article by: Melinda Eddleman

For individuals planning to continue or even start their studies over the summer, Del Mar College will offer credit courses during its Summer I and II sessions. Online registration begins Monday, April 13.

Summer I courses begin May 26, and Summer II courses start on July 6.

The College will deliver summer courses online and in hybrid formats, which may include face-to-face classes, depending on evolving COVID-19 precautions.

DMC will also offer Maymester online courses May 7-22. Online registration for those credit classes is currently underway and will run through May 7, the same day classes begin.

Both current and prospective students can access WebDMC to view course offerings, which will include frequent updates and additions throughout the registration process. WebDMC is also where students can check their financial aid status, review their degree plan and find other information.

Current students who plan to take summer courses can visit the DMC “Prepare to Register” web page for more information. Prospective students can visit “Becoming a Viking” to complete the admissions process and for other information.
